Of my hiking buddies, he’s my favorite. I gather my gear meticulously – I don’t want to weigh myself down unnecessarily unless I want to be left in the dust. He’s always a few steps ahead with that happy smile, ready to tackle the next hill.
He doesn’t carry a pack and is always barefoot, yet I am amazed with his ingenuity in tackling the trails we follow. I’m thankful we tackle those trails together.
I whistle, “You ready, boy?” A moment later he’s bounding out of the backseat, full of enthusiasm, his leash barely containing him. “I love you, boy!”

Of course this is about my sweet dogs and not my children!
